00:04:10 In fact, you might remember, just talking about JW Broadcasting,
00:04:14 that it was October of 2014
00:04:17 when the first broadcast aired, and that was with Brother Lett.
00:04:20 And we know that was only in one language.
00:04:24 And now what do we have?
00:04:26 With the approval of the Governing Body,
00:04:28 they have increased the languages starting first in English.
00:04:32 Now, we know that the Gilead graduation has been added
00:04:35 and the annual meeting has been added
00:04:37 to the broadcast throughout the year.
00:04:40 Well, originally, the translators around the world
00:04:43 were doing their best to keep up with all
00:04:45 the other translation that was needed,
00:04:47 and they were not able to do the Gilead graduation or the annual meeting.
00:04:52 But interestingly, the Governing Body now has put those on as monthly broadcasts.
00:04:57 What has that done for the organization?
00:05:00 It has united us.
00:05:02 In 2016, there were only 34 languages
00:05:05 able to translate the Gilead graduation.
00:05:08 Now 162 languages
00:05:12 have that deep spiritual truth.
00:05:14 And the same is true with the annual meeting.
00:05:16 Now thousands of our brothers and sisters have that same spiritual food,
00:05:21 that feeding program that we have been enjoying for many years.

00:07:54 When we think about paper clips (I did a little research on this),
00:07:58 paper clips come, of course, in different shapes, sizes, and colors.
00:08:03 But what’s the purpose of a paper clip?
00:08:05 Isn’t it to hold pieces of paper together?
00:08:09 Isn’t that the same with you and me?
00:08:11 The purpose that we have as Jehovah’s Witnesses
00:08:14 is to unite, to be a uniting factor,
00:08:17 in our family, in the congregation,
00:08:20 here at Bethel, or in any aspect of our organization.
00:08:24 And it’s interesting that the engineers of paper clips
00:08:28 actually have something that is called “yield stress,”
00:08:31 or “the amount of stress needed to permanently reshape the wire.”
00:08:36 If it has too much stress,
00:08:38 that means it’ll be hard to open and unite the paper.
00:08:41 If it has too low of a yield stress, then it becomes wimpy,
00:08:45 and it won’t hold anything together.
00:08:47 So we can see where you and I
00:08:49 need to have some rigidness in us.
00:08:52 We need to stand firm,
00:08:54 but we need to have those Christian qualities
00:08:56 to be yielding and to be peaceable.
